London Mayor blasts moving of Greening "to expand Heathrow"
The Mayor of London has blasted the PM's decision to move Justine Greening from the DfT in order "to expand Heathrow".
Boris Johnson told Politics Home: "There can be only one reason to move her - and that is to expand Heathrow Airport. It is simply mad to build a new runway in the middle of west London. Nearly a third of the victims of aircraft noise in the whole of Europe live in the vicinity of Heathrow."
